Explain vectorization and hamming distance
WebJun 27, 2024 · Hamming distance is a metric for comparing two binary data strings. While comparing two binary strings of equal length, Hamming distance is the number of bit positions in which the two bits are different. The Hamming distance between two … WebJan 13, 2024 · I am trying to calculate the Hamming distance between a binary vector and a matrix of binary vectors. The fastest approach I could find is using unsigned 8 bit integers with Numpy: ... then it u32 sum vectorization fails – Noah. Jan 15, 2024 at 17:56. I really would have thought narrowest width possible would be best because its just less ...
Explain vectorization and hamming distance
Did you know?
WebMay 31, 2024 · Numpy only makes your code much faster if you use it to vectorize your work. In your case you can make use of array broadcasting to vectorize your problem: compare your two arrays and create an auxiliary array of shape (N,M,K) which you can sum along its third dimension:. hamming_distance = (X[:,None,:] != X_train).sum(axis=-1) WebThe Hamming distance of two codewords. Consider the binary alphabet {0, 1}, and let the two codewords be v i = (010110) and V j = (011011). The Hamming distance between the two codewords is d(v i, v j) = 3. Indeed, if we number the bit position in each n-tuple from left to right as 1 to 6, the two n-tuples differ in bit positions 3, 4, and 6 ...
WebThe numbers behind the 'bars/underscores' are the parity-check bits, it means that in each column/row is even count of number 1. So the minimum distance equals to 2. That means according to the rule t < d, that this code can detect only a t-bit error, which means 1 ( but that's not true, because it can detect 3 bit erros). WebApr 30, 2024 · The greater the Levenshtein distance, the greater are the difference between the strings. For example, from "test" to "test" the Levenshtein distance is 0 because both the source and target strings are identical. No transformations are needed. In contrast, from "test" to "team" the Levenshtein distance is 2 - two substitutions have to …
WebJan 3, 2011 · Hamming distance can be considered the upper bound for possible Levenshtein distances between two sequences, so if I am comparing the two sequences for a order-biased similarity metric rather than the absolute minimal number of moves to match the sequences, there isn't an apparent reason for me to choose Levenshtein over … http://users.umiacs.umd.edu/~joseph/classes/enee752/Fall09/Solutions1.pdf
WebMay 30, 2016 · I think that the Hamming distance is similar to the SMC, since both of them look at whole dataset and compare data points similar or dissimilar. But the solution of this book just like following: The Hamming distance is similar to the SMC. In fact, SMC = Hamming distance / number of bits. Did solution make mistake?
WebApr 4, 2024 · Hamming Distance between two integers is the number of bits that are different at the same position in both numbers. Examples: Input: n1 = 9, n2 = 14 Output: 3 9 = 1001, 14 = 1110 No. of Different bits = 3 Input: n1 = 4, n2 = 8 Output: 2 Recommended: Please try your approach on {IDE} first, before moving on to the solution. Approach: emarates animationWebFeb 1, 2024 · Hamming distance. Image by the author. Hamming distance is the number of values that are different between two vectors. It is typically used to compare two binary strings of equal length. It can also … emarathWebDec 26, 2024 · Hamming code is a set of error-correction codes that can be used to detect and correct the errors that can occur when the data is … emaraaty ana horseWebMar 11, 2024 · History of Hamming code. Hamming code is a technique build by R.W.Hamming to detect errors. Hamming code should be applied to data units of any length and uses the relationship between data and … emarathi.inWebNov 10, 2024 · Here generalized means that we can manipulate the above formula to calculate the distance between two data points in different ways. As mentioned above, we can manipulate the value of p and ... ford speaker wire colorsWebAug 9, 2024 · Converting to a vector of numerical values using Bag of character vectorization: Hamming Distance It is the distance measured between two words assuming both has the same length or it is defined as the number of positions that have symbols between two words of equal length. Hamming Distance Manhattan Distance emarat in hindiWebMar 6, 2024 · So to make our lives easier we will vectorize our initial equation! There are a couple of steps we need to take in order to vectorize our equation. First, we rename our m m and b b to \theta_1 θ1 and \theta_0 θ0. So instead of writing. f (x) = mx+b f (x)=mx + b. emarald wild west